The Right Candidate for Permanent MakeUp

The Right Candidate for Permanent MakeUp
  • COULD THIS BE YOU?

  • Poor eyesight, shaky hands and lack of artistic ability
  • Hair loss in the brow line due to hereditary factors, hormonal changes, excessive tweezing, disease, etc.
  • Loss of eyelashes, sparse lashes, upper lash line pulled up or lower lash line pulled down, due to surgery or injury
  • Upper and lower lip do not match, scars in lip line, lips too pale or too thin
  • Allergic reaction to make up
  • Oily skin causes your make up to smudge
